'We've been hemmed in' - Anger over underground reservoir
Springwell Village residents say they feel "misled" by plans to build an underground reservoir there.
Northumbrian Water says it needs to build the site to eventually supply 250,000 homes, but locals say nobody realised just how tall it would be.
